Harcourt Assessment Enhances Customer Experience with Harcourt Spectrum; Runs on IBM's Websphere Portal Software, Easy to Order and Track Test Materials and Manage Assessment Programs
Business Wire, May 19, 2005
SAN ANTONIO -- Leading test publisher Harcourt Assessment, Inc. has introduced Harcourt Spectrum(TM), a friendly Internet portal that makes it easy for customers to order test materials, track shipments, manage enrollment and student data, and update organizational information.
Harcourt Spectrum enables these tasks in a highly secure, highly available environment through any commercially available Web browser and an Internet connection. No additional hardware or software is required to begin using Harcourt Spectrum.
When fully implemented later this year, Harcourt Spectrum will give customers complete visibility into their assessment programs and an unprecedented ability to manage their programs online.
Harcourt Spectrum will be offered initially for custom assessment programs and later for the company's education, psychology and other catalog products.
Currently in use with select customers, Harcourt Spectrum provides a single "gateway" into Harcourt, and is tightly integrated into Harcourt's proven back-end systems to provide customers with a seamless experience from beginning to end.
Because it was designed to be flexible, Harcourt Spectrum can be tailored to meet the specific needs of each customer and is easily configured to use the customer's familiar terminology, logos and branding.

The current release of Harcourt Spectrum supports the following
services:
-- Order Management and Tracking -- Customers can order test
materials and monitor the status through the entire order
lifecycle. This includes tracking orders as they move through
Harcourt's fulfillment systems, and tracking shipment status
as the order makes its way to the customer's doorstep.
-- Organization and Enrollment Management -- Customers can submit
organization and enrollment data, uploaded from a customer's
file or entered directly online. Information can be updated
real-time to ensure that Harcourt has the most current
information to support the customer's program.
-- E-mail Notification -- Customers can request e-mail
notifications when specific events occur, such as an order
shipment.
Later this year, Harcourt Spectrum will support these additional
services:
-- Student Data Management -- Customers will be able to upload
and maintain student demographic data throughout the testing
window, as well as during scoring and reporting. This
capability will set the stage for longitudinal tracking of
assessment results throughout a student's education.
-- Results Management -- Customers will be able to view and print
score reports. Additionally, this service will integrate into
Harcourt Results Online for rich online reporting of
assessment results.
-- Scoring Order Management -- Customers will be able to track
the status of scoring orders.
-- Collaborative Services -- These services will enable instant
chat with Harcourt's customer support center, instant messages
with Harcourt colleagues, as well as discussion boards and
document libraries.
Based in San Antonio, Harcourt Assessment is a leading provider of high-quality assessment instruments and testing programs used by educators, psychologists, speech-language pathologists, occupational therapists, human resource professionals, admissions and credentialing professionals, and businesses. Through the development of custom statewide educational testing programs, Harcourt is helping more than 20 states meet the accountability requirements of the federal No Child Left Behind Act.
